Understanding Knee Anatomy:
What Is the Meniscus?
The knee joint is formed by three bones:
Femur (thigh bone)
Tibia (shin bone)
Patella (kneecap)
Inside the knee sit two menisci:
Medial Meniscus
Located on the inner side of the knee.
Lateral Meniscus
Located on the outer side of the knee.
The menisci are crescent-shaped cartilage structures that help:
✓ Distribute load across the knee
✓ Improve shock absorption
✓ Increase joint stability
✓ Protect the articular cartilage
✓ Assist movement mechanics
Without healthy menisci, forces through the knee become more concentrated, potentially increasing stress on cartilage surfaces.
What Causes Meniscal Injuries?
Meniscal injuries may occur through:
Traumatic Injury
Common in sport or active individuals.
Examples include:
Twisting while the foot remains planted
Sudden change of direction
Pivoting movements
Deep squatting under load
Landing and rotational forces
Sports commonly associated include football, rugby, basketball and skiing.
Degenerative Changes
In middle-aged and older adults, menisci may weaken over time.
Sometimes simple activities such as:
Kneeling
Squatting
Standing from a chair
Turning suddenly
can lead to symptoms.
Degenerative tears often occur alongside cartilage wear or early osteoarthritis.
Types of Meniscal Injury
Different tear patterns influence treatment decisions.
Longitudinal Tear
Runs parallel with the meniscal fibres. May progress into a bucket handle tear if displaced.
Bucket Handle Tear
A fragment flips inward and may block knee motion.
Common symptoms:
Locking
Reduced extension
Mechanical catching
Often considered for surgical repair.
Radial Tear
Runs from inner edge outward. Can significantly affect load distribution.
Horizontal Tear
Splits upper and lower surfaces.More frequently seen in degenerative knees.
Flap Tear
Loose fragment causing clicking or catching.
Root Tear
Occurs where the meniscus attaches to bone.
Loss of root function can behave similarly to losing the entire meniscus and may accelerate cartilage overload.
Is Surgery Always Needed?
No. Many meniscal injuries improve with:
Strength training
Load management
Progressive exercise
Movement retraining
Activity modification
Surgery is usually considered when:
Possible Surgical Indicators
Locked knee
Large displaced tear
Persistent mechanical symptoms
Meniscal root injury
Failed rehabilitation
Associated ligament injury
Young athletic patients with repairable tears
Significant cartilage damage
Treatment decisions should always consider:
Age + symptoms + imaging + function + goals
MRI findings alone do not automatically mean surgery is required.
